The Opportunity:
As a Medical Officer, you will be the lead first aider, ensuring the health and safety of students, staff, and visitors. You will manage medical records, administer medication, and support students with specific medical needs. This is a vital role in maintaining a safe and inclusive learning environment.
Key Responsibilities:
- Act as the first point of contact for all student medical needs and ensure compliance with school policies.
- Maintain accurate and up-to-date medical records and incident reports.
- Administer first aid to students, staff, and visitors, and summon emergency services when necessary.
- Ensure secure storage and correct administration of medication.
- Coordinate the ordering, maintenance, and distribution of medical supplies.
- Support daily intimate care routines for students with medical conditions.
- Manage the hygiene suite and medical room to ensure cleanliness and safety.
- Liaise with senior leadership, medical professionals, and parents to develop and implement health care plans.
- Lead the completion of health risk assessments and ensure relevant staff are informed.
- Work with the EVC Coordinator to ensure medical needs are considered for all academy trips.
- Support the setup and management of PEEPs for students with specific needs.
- Coordinate student immunisations and health checks with the NHS.
- Organise and manage first aid training for staff and update associated records.
- Undergo training to use specialist medical equipment such as EpiPens.
- Support safeguarding and attendance teams to ensure students with medical conditions can attend school effectively.
- Discuss medical requirements with prospective parents and assist in creating health care plans.
